The first step is to identify the kind of key you own. There are two types of key one being one is a Chrome SmartKey (r) and an older SmartKey (r).

To determine which type of key you're using, check the panic button on your fob. The panic button on a Chrome SmartKey(r) which is more recent and has a triangular design. A previous SmartKey(r) however, has the shape of a circular panic button.

Many of these keys come with microchips that communicate with the engine control unit (ECU). This allows you to start your vehicle. These keys are often referred to as smart keys. They are more user-friendly than traditional key fobs.

When a key goes into the ignition the ignition switch will activate a series of switches which supply power to different parts of your car's electrical system. These switches control the circuits which power your vehicle's lights or radio, among other features.

If a key doesn't turn in the ignition, it could be a sign that the switch is damaged or been damaged or gone bad. A damaged switch could stop your key from turning on and could cause your vehicle's to stop.
